## AgriPulse Gateway 2.6.0 — Changed Defaults

Support team, please read carefully: this release changes several defaults on the farm-equipment telemetry gateway. Upload batching is now enabled out of the box, the offline buffer window is longer, and low-signal retries back off more aggressively. Customers who never edited their config will pick these up automatically on upgrade; customers with custom configs are unaffected. When triaging tickets, compare the customer's file against the new defaults, which are:

deployment values, bajop-yahaf:
[holax]
host = holax.tolvaqsys.corp
user = holax_svc
database = holax_prod

# Artifact Signing — Replica Lag Alarm Runbook

The Quillbank pipeline signs every artifact before promotion. During the recent read-replica lag alarm on the metadata store, signature verification queries hit stale replicas and returned not-found for freshly signed builds, triggering false integrity alerts. Verification now pins to the primary for five minutes post-signing. Reviewers should confirm the alarm threshold (120s lag) remains appropriate. For audit completeness, the current signing key is recorded below.

deploy key for kaduf-bagep: bky6_NNeq4d

Scuttlefin retries failed webhook deliveries with exponential backoff. A delivery counts as failed on any non-2xx response or a timeout. Max five attempts, then the event lands in the dead-letter queue; ops reviews that queue daily. Backoff starts at 30 seconds and doubles per attempt, with jitter. Do not manually replay from the DLQ without checking for duplicate side effects downstream. Consumers must be idempotent — we guarantee at-least-once. Current retry configuration for the production dispatcher is as follows.

deployment values, yafop-tahof:
HOLIX_HOST=holix.zemvarsys.internal
HOLIX_PORT=3306

**Q: How do I trace a request through Hollowpine's microservices from my plugin?**

A: Propagate the trace header unchanged. Don't mint your own trace IDs; the gateway does that. Spans from plugins show up in the Glimmer trace viewer under your plugin's registered name. Sampling is 10% in production — don't assume every request is traced. If the viewer shows a locked workspace, your plugin sandbox needs recovery access. Unlock it with the passphrase below.

recovery phrase for fawif-tajeg: norael-aldmir-casir-brivan-ulaion